هوش مصنوعی

15 نکته راهنما و آموزش کامل استفاده از کوپایلوت




15 نکته <a href="/14-%d9%86%da%a9%d8%aa%d9%87-%d8%b1%d8%a7%d9%87%d9%86%d9%85%d8%a7-%d9%88-%d8%a2%d9%85%d9%88%d8%b2%d8%b4-%da%a9%d8%a7%d9%85%d9%84-%d8%a7%d8%b3%d8%aa%d9%81%d8%a7%d8%af%d9%87-%d8%a7%d8%b2-chatgpt-20/" target="_blank">راهنما و آموزش</a> کامل بهره‌گیری از کوپایلوت

کوپایلوت (Copilot) ابزار هوش مصنوعی مایکروسافت است که جهت کمک به کاربران در زمینه‌های مختلف، از جمله برنامه‌نویسی، تولید محتوا و حل مسائل روزمره طراحی شده است. این ابزار قدرتمند با بهره‌گیری از الگوریتم‌های یادگیری ماشین، می‌تواند در درک زبان طبیعی، ارائه پیشنهادات هوشمندانه و تولید کد کمک شایانی به شما بکند.

Artificial intelligence-هوش مصنوعی

در این پست، 15 نکته کلیدی و کاربردی برای استفاده بهینه از کوپایلوت را با شما به اشتراک می‌گذاریم:

  • 2. دستورات (Prompt) دقیق و واضح بنویسید:

    کیفیت خروجی کوپایلوت مستقیماً به کیفیت دستورات شما بستگی دارد. سعی کنید دستورات خود را تا حد امکان دقیق، واضح و بدون ابهام بنویسید. هرچه اطلاعات بیشتری در اختیار کوپایلوت قرار دهید، نتایج بهتری دریافت خواهید کرد.
  • 3. از مثال‌ها استفاده کنید:

    اگر می‌خواهید کوپایلوت کد خاصی را تولید کند، به جای توضیح کلی، یک مثال از کد مورد نظر را در دستور خود قرار دهید. این کار به کوپایلوت کمک می‌کند تا منظور شما را بهتر درک کند.
  • 4. از کلمات کلیدی مناسب استفاده کنید:

    بهره‌گیری از کلمات کلیدی مرتبط با موضوع در دستورات، به کوپایلوت کمک می‌کند تا سریع‌تر و دقیق‌تر به خواسته شما پاسخ دهد.
  • 5. از کوپایلوت برای تولید اسکلت اولیه کد استفاده کنید:

    به جای نوشتن کل کد از صفر، می‌توانید از کوپایلوت برای تولید اسکلت اولیه و ساختار اصلی کد استفاده کنید. سپس، می‌توانید با ویرایش و تکمیل کد تولید شده، به نتیجه مطلوب خود برسید.
  • 6. از کوپایلوت برای مستندسازی کد استفاده کنید:

    کوپایلوت می‌تواند به شما در مستندسازی کد کمک کند. با بهره‌گیری از دستورات مناسب، می‌توانید توضیحات و کامنت‌های لازم را به کد خود اضافه کنید.
  • 7. از کوپایلوت برای رفع اشکالات کد استفاده کنید:

    اگر در کد خود با مشکلی روبرو شده‌اید، می‌توانید کد را به کوپایلوت بدهید و از آن بخواهید که اشکالات را شناسایی و رفع کند.
  • 8. از کوپایلوت برای ترجمه کد استفاده کنید:

    کوپایلوت می‌تواند کد را از یک زبان برنامه‌نویسی به زبان دیگر ترجمه کند. این قابلیت می‌تواند در پروژه‌های چند زبانه بسیار مفید باشد.
  • 9. از کوپایلوت برای تولید محتوای متنی استفاده کنید:

    کوپایلوت می‌تواند به شما در تولید محتوای متنی مانند مقالات، پست‌های وبلاگ، ایمیل‌ها و . . . کمک کند.
  • محتوا پادشاه است

  • 10. از کوپایلوت برای خلاصه کردن متون استفاده کنید:

    اگر با متن طولانی روبرو هستید، می‌توانید از کوپایلوت برای خلاصه کردن آن استفاده کنید.
  • 11. از کوپایلوت برای پاسخ به سوالات خود استفاده کنید:

    کوپایلوت می‌تواند به سوالات شما در زمینه‌های مختلف پاسخ دهد.
  • 12. از کوپایلوت برای ایده‌پردازی استفاده کنید:

    اگر به دنبال ایده‌های جدید هستید، می‌توانید از کوپایلوت برای ایده‌پردازی استفاده کنید.
  • ایده

  • 13. به بازخورد کوپایلوت توجه کنید:

    کوپایلوت اغلب بازخوردهایی را در مورد دستورات و کدهای شما ارائه می‌دهد. به این بازخوردها توجه کنید و از آنها برای بهبود عملکرد خود استفاده کنید.
  • 14. کوپایلوت را با داده‌های خود آموزش دهید:

    در برخی موارد، می‌توانید کوپایلوت را با داده‌های خاص خود آموزش دهید تا عملکرد آن را در زمینه‌های تخصصی بهبود بخشید.

با بهره‌گیری از این نکات، می‌توانید از کوپایلوت به طور موثرتری استفاده کنید و بهره‌وری خود را در زمینه‌های مختلف افزایش دهید.

همواره به روز رسانی های کوپایلوت توجه داشته باشید.






15 نکته راهنما و آموزش کامل بهره‌گیری از کوپایلوت

1. آشنایی با کوپایلوت: دستیار هوشمند شما

کوپایلوت (Copilot) یک ابزار هوش مصنوعی قدرتمند است که توسط مایکروسافت توسعه داده شده است. این ابزار جهت کمک به کاربران در انجام وظایف مختلف، از جمله کدنویسی، نوشتن ایمیل، تهیه محتوا و موارد دیگر طراحی شده است. کوپایلوت با تحلیل متون و کدهای موجود، می‌تواند پیشنهادات هوشمندانه‌ای ارائه دهد و به شما در تسریع فرآیند کار کمک کند. در واقع، کوپایلوت می‌تواند به عنوان یک همکار مجازی عمل کرده و در بهبود بهره‌وری شما نقش مهمی ایفا کند. این ابزار در محیط‌های مختلفی قابل استفاده است، از جمله Visual Studio Code، Visual Studio و GitHub. همین گستردگی، کوپایلوت را به یک ابزار بسیار ارزشمند برای توسعه‌دهندگان و سایر متخصصان تبدیل کرده است.

2. شروع کدنویسی با پیشنهادات هوشمندانه

یکی از مهم‌ترین کاربردهای کوپایلوت، کمک به کدنویسی است. کافی است شروع به نوشتن کد کنید، کوپایلوت به طور خودکار پیشنهادات مختلفی را بر اساس زمینه کد و زبان برنامه‌نویسی مورد استفاده ارائه می‌دهد. این پیشنهادات می‌تواند شامل تکمیل خودکار توابع، کلاس‌ها، عبارات شرطی و حتی کل بلاک‌های کد باشد. برای پذیرش پیشنهاد، معمولاً کافی است کلید Tab را فشار دهید و کوپایلوت به طور خودکار کد را وارد می‌کند. کوپایلوت با یادگیری از الگوهای کدنویسی شما، پیشنهادات خود را به مرور زمان بهبود می‌بخشد و به یک دستیار کدنویسی بسیار قدرتمند تبدیل می‌شود.

3. توضیح کد با بهره‌گیری از کوپایلوت

این قابلیت به ویژه برای درک سریع کدهای پیچیده و آشنایی با پروژه‌های جدید بسیار مفید است. توضیحات کوپایلوت معمولاً به زبان ساده و قابل فهم ارائه می‌شوند. برای بهره‌گیری از این قابلیت، معمولاً یک گزینه “Explain this” یا مشابه آن در منوی راست کلیک وجود دارد. با انتخاب این گزینه، کوپایلوت توضیحات لازم را ارائه می‌دهد.

4. ایجاد تست واحد (Unit Test)

نوشتن تست واحد یکی از جنبه‌های حیاتی توسعه نرم‌افزار است.کوپایلوت می‌تواند به شما در تولید تست‌های واحد کمک کند.با انتخاب کد مورد نظر و درخواست ایجاد تست، کوپایلوت مجموعه‌ای از تست‌های پیشنهادی را ارائه می‌دهد.البته، این تست‌ها ممکن است نیاز به ویرایش و تنظیم داشته باشند، اما به عنوان یک نقطه شروع بسیار عالی عمل می‌کنند.کوپایلوت با تحلیل کد، سناریوهای مختلف تست را شناسایی کرده و تست‌های مناسب را تولید می‌کند.این قابلیت به ویژه برای توسعه‌دهندگانی که زمان کافی برای نوشتن تست‌های واحد ندارند، بسیار مفید است.

با بهره‌گیری از کوپایلوت، می‌توانید به سرعت پوشش تست کد خود را افزایش دهید.

برای بهره‌گیری از این قابلیت، معمولاً یک گزینه “Generate Unit Tests” یا مشابه آن در منوی راست کلیک وجود دارد.با انتخاب این گزینه، کوپایلوت تست‌های پیشنهادی را ارائه می‌دهد.

5. ترجمه کد به زبان‌های برنامه‌نویسی دیگر

کوپایلوت می‌تواند کد نوشته شده به یک زبان برنامه‌نویسی را به زبان دیگری ترجمه کند. این قابلیت می‌تواند برای انتقال کد از یک پلتفرم به پلتفرم دیگر یا برای یادگیری زبان‌های برنامه‌نویسی جدید بسیار مفید باشد. البته، ترجمه کد به طور کامل خودکار نیست و ممکن است نیاز به ویرایش و تنظیم داشته باشد. اما کوپایلوت می‌تواند یک نقطه شروع خوب برای ترجمه کد ارائه دهد. برای بهره‌گیری از این قابلیت، باید به کوپایلوت دستور دهید که کد را به زبان مورد نظر ترجمه کند. می‌توانید از دستورات متنی یا نظرات در کد برای این منظور استفاده کنید. مثلا می‌توانید در کد خود بنویسید: “// Translate this code to Python” و سپس کوپایلوت کد معادل را به زبان پایتون ارائه می‌دهد.

6. تولید مستندات کد (Code Documentation)

این قابلیت به ویژه برای پروژه‌های بزرگ و پیچیده بسیار مفید است. با بهره‌گیری از کوپایلوت، می‌توانید به سرعت مستندات جامعی برای کد خود ایجاد کنید. برای بهره‌گیری از این قابلیت، معمولاً یک گزینه “Generate Documentation” یا مشابه آن در منوی راست کلیک وجود دارد. با انتخاب این گزینه، کوپایلوت مستندات پیشنهادی را ارائه می‌دهد.

7. بهره‌گیری از دستورات متنی (Text Prompts)

کوپایلوت علاوه بر پیشنهادات خودکار، از دستورات متنی نیز پشتیبانی می‌کند. شما می‌توانید با نوشتن دستورات متنی، از کوپایلوت بخواهید که وظایف خاصی را انجام دهد. مثلا می‌توانید از کوپایلوت بخواهید که تابعی برای مرتب‌سازی یک آرایه بنویسد یا یک عبارت منظم برای اعتبارسنجی آدرس ایمیل ایجاد کند. هرچه دستورات شما دقیق‌تر و واضح‌تر باشند، نتایج بهتری دریافت خواهید کرد. سعی کنید جزئیات لازم را در دستورات خود ذکر کنید تا کوپایلوت بتواند به درستی منظور شما را درک کند. برای بهره‌گیری از این قابلیت، می‌توانید از نظرات (Comments) در کد خود استفاده کنید. با نوشتن دستورات متنی در نظرات، کوپایلوت به طور خودکار پاسخ می‌دهد.

8. بهره‌گیری از میانبرهای صفحه کلید (Keyboard Shortcuts)

یادگیری و بهره‌گیری از میانبرهای صفحه کلید کوپایلوت می‌تواند سرعت کار شما را به طور قابل توجهی افزایش دهد. با بهره‌گیری از میانبرها، می‌توانید به سرعت به قابلیت‌های مختلف کوپایلوت دسترسی پیدا کنید. لیست کامل میانبرهای صفحه کلید را می‌توانید در تنظیمات کوپایلوت پیدا کنید. برخی از میانبرهای پرکاربرد عبارتند از: نمایش پیشنهادات، پذیرش پیشنهاد، رد پیشنهاد و غیره. سعی کنید به مرور زمان میانبرهای پرکاربرد را یاد بگیرید و از آنها در کار خود استفاده کنید. این کار باعث می‌شود که بهره‌وری شما به طور چشمگیری افزایش یابد.

9. تنظیمات کوپایلوت برای بهینه‌سازی عملکرد

کوپایلوت دارای تنظیمات مختلفی است که به شما امکان می‌دهد عملکرد آن را مطابق با نیازهای خود بهینه‌سازی کنید. می‌توانید تنظیمات مربوط به زبان‌های برنامه‌نویسی، سبک کدنویسی و سایر موارد را تغییر دهید. مثلا می‌توانید مشخص کنید که کوپایلوت در چه زبان‌های برنامه‌نویسی فعال باشد یا چه سبک کدنویسی را ترجیح دهد. این تنظیمات به کوپایلوت کمک می‌کنند تا پیشنهادات دقیق‌تری ارائه دهد. توصیه می‌شود که تنظیمات کوپایلوت را بر اساس نیازهای خود تنظیم کنید تا بهترین نتیجه را از آن دریافت کنید.

10. حل مشکلات رایج با کوپایلوت

گاهی اوقات ممکن است با مشکلاتی در بهره‌گیری از کوپایلوت مواجه شوید. مثلا ممکن است کوپایلوت پیشنهادی ارائه ندهد یا پیشنهادات آن نادرست باشند. در این صورت، می‌توانید راهکارهای زیر را امتحان کنید:اگر همچنان مشکل دارید، سعی کنید محیط توسعه خود را مجدداً راه‌اندازی کنید. این کار می‌تواند مشکلات مربوط به حافظه و سایر منابع سیستم را حل کند. اگر هیچ‌کدام از راهکارهای بالا جواب نداد، می‌توانید با پشتیبانی مایکروسافت تماس بگیرید. آنها می‌توانند به شما در رفع مشکلات مربوط به کوپایلوت کمک کنند.

11. نوشتن ایمیل‌های حرفه‌ای با کوپایلوت

این قابلیت به ویژه برای افرادی که زمان کافی برای نوشتن ایمیل ندارند یا در نوشتن ایمیل مشکل دارند، بسیار مفید است. کوپایلوت می‌تواند به شما در نوشتن ایمیل‌های رسمی، درخواست‌ها، گزارش‌ها و سایر موارد کمک کند. برای بهره‌گیری از این قابلیت، کافی است موضوع ایمیل و اطلاعات لازم را به کوپایلوت ارائه دهید. سپس، کوپایلوت پیش‌نویس ایمیل را تولید می‌کند. شما می‌توانید پیش‌نویس را ویرایش و تکمیل کنید. این قابلیت در برنامه‌هایی مانند Outlook و Gmail نیز قابل استفاده است.

12. تولید ایده‌های خلاقانه برای محتوا

کوپایلوت می‌تواند به شما در تولید ایده‌های خلاقانه برای محتوا نیز کمک کند. اگر به دنبال موضوعی برای نوشتن وبلاگ، پست شبکه‌های اجتماعی یا ارائه هستید، کوپایلوت می‌تواند ایده‌های مختلفی را به شما پیشنهاد دهد. برای بهره‌گیری از این قابلیت، کافی است یک کلمه کلیدی یا موضوع کلی را به کوپایلوت ارائه دهید. سپس، کوپایلوت لیستی از ایده‌های مختلف را به شما پیشنهاد می‌دهد. این قابلیت به ویژه برای افرادی که در زمینه تولید محتوا فعالیت می‌کنند، بسیار مفید است. کوپایلوت می‌تواند به شما در کشف موضوعات جدید و جذاب کمک کند. البته، ایده‌های تولید شده توسط کوپایلوت ممکن است نیاز به ویرایش و تکمیل داشته باشند. اما به عنوان یک نقطه شروع بسیار عالی عمل می‌کنند.

13. خلاصه کردن متون طولانی

کوپایلوت می‌تواند متون طولانی را به خلاصه‌های کوتاه‌تر و قابل فهم‌تر تبدیل کند. این قابلیت به ویژه برای مطالعه سریع مقالات، گزارش‌ها و سایر متون طولانی بسیار مفید است. برای بهره‌گیری از این قابلیت، کافی است متن مورد نظر را به کوپایلوت ارائه دهید. سپس، کوپایلوت خلاصه‌ای از متن را تولید می‌کند. این قابلیت در برنامه‌هایی مانند مایکروسافت Word و گوگل Docs نیز قابل استفاده است.

14. بهبود مهارت‌های زبانی

کوپایلوت می‌تواند به شما در بهبود مهارت‌های زبانی نیز کمک کند. این ابزار می‌تواند غلط‌های املایی و گرامری شما را تصحیح کند و پیشنهادات بهتری برای انتخاب کلمات و عبارات ارائه دهد. برای بهره‌گیری از این قابلیت، کافی است متن خود را در کوپایلوت تایپ کنید. سپس، کوپایلوت به طور خودکار غلط‌های املایی و گرامری را شناسایی کرده و پیشنهادات لازم را ارائه می‌دهد. این قابلیت به ویژه برای افرادی که زبان مادری آنها انگلیسی نیست یا در نوشتن به زبان انگلیسی مشکل دارند، بسیار مفید است. کوپایلوت می‌تواند به شما در نوشتن متون صحیح و روان کمک کند. این قابلیت در برنامه‌هایی مانند مایکروسافت Word و گوگل Docs نیز قابل استفاده است.

15. بهره‌گیری از کوپایلوت در جلسات آنلاین

برای بهره‌گیری از این قابلیت، باید کوپایلوت را به جلسه آنلاین خود متصل کنید. سپس، کوپایلوت به طور خودکار صدا را ضبط کرده و متن آن را تولید می‌کند. این قابلیت در برنامه‌هایی مانند مایکروسافت Teams و Zoom نیز قابل استفاده است.

نمایش بیشتر

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ا